| Oakmoss | Botanical Name: Evernia prunastri
Common Method of Extraction: Solvent Extracted
The description of aroma: Rich, earthy, woody.
Strength of Initial Aroma: Medium
Perfumery Note: Base
Color: Light Brown
Consistency: Medium - Thin
It can be used in: Perfumery
Safety Issues: Be very careful while using. It is dermal sensitizer and mucous membrane irritant. It is toxic. It should not be used by pregnant women and people who suffer from epilepsy.
